New Orleans, Louisiana AA Meetings

Living with alcohol use disorder (AUD) is challenging in any city. Still, it might be even more challenging in New Orleans, Lousiana, with its round-the-clock nightlife and the festive spirit of Mardi Gras. AA meetings in New Orleans offer the support of like-minded people who have found a way to successfully live without alcohol who are willing to welcome you to their community. AUD is a chronic medical condition characterized by a person’s inability to control or stop drinking, even with evidence that it is destroying their lives. People with AUD find it nearly impossible to recover without outside help and ongoing support. Alcoholics Anonymous has been the go-to group for AUD recovery since it began in 1935. Various meetings in the area offer diverse people support, including meetings for beginners, 12-step meetings, women’s or men’s only meetings, LGBT meetings, and more. The AA program is found in the 12 Steps of AA located in the Big Book of Alcoholics Anonymous; this trusted program provides a spiritual framework for participants to examine their lives with structured steps that members practice in all their activities. When members gather at AA meetings in Louisiana, they share their experiences using the 12-steps, inspiring everyone. Begin attending New Orleans meetings and get started on the road to recovery.
